Comprehending Mental Health Diagnosis
Mental health diagnosis involves a comprehensive examination by a certified professional, normally a psychiatrist or clinical psychologist. The procedure encompasses assessing a patient's mental status through interviews, observations, and different psychometric tests. The objective is to identify any mental illness and advise proper treatment options.

Here's what the typical journey may appear like:
Initial Consultation: Patients consult with a mental health professional to discuss their issues and history. Assessment: The clinician may use standardized tools and interviews to assess the client's present frame of mind. Diagnosis: Based on the assessment, the clinician will provide a diagnosis, if relevant, referencing the DSM-5 or ICD-10 categories. Treatment Plan: The clinician collaborates with the patient to establish an individualized treatment strategy, which might consist of treatment, medication, or other interventions. Follow-Up: Patients typically participate in ongoing consultations to keep an eye on progress and change the treatment strategy as needed.Typical Mental Health Disorders Diagnosed

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Just how much does a private mental health diagnosis cost in the UK?
Expenses can differ substantially depending on the service provider, area, and type of assessment. Anticipate to pay between ₤ 200 to ₤ 500 for an initial assessment, with follow-up sessions usually costing in between ₤ 100 and ₤ 250.
2. Is a private mental health diagnosis recognized by the NHS?
Yes, a diagnosis from a private clinician can be recognized by the NHS, specifically if consulting for further care or treatment alternatives.
3. The length of time does it require to get a private mental health diagnosis?
The timeframe can range from a couple of days to several weeks, depending on the professional's schedule.
4. Do I need a referral for a private mental health diagnosis?
No referral is typically needed, but clients must choose companies who satisfy their particular needs and preferences.
